This catalogue of an an exhibition at the Museum of 20th- and 21st-Century Art in St. Petersburg displays the work of three artists. Tatiana Nazarene has a style that mixes the stark clear forms of icon painting with grotesque and ironic distortions. Her paintings published here date to the 1990s and early 2000s. Alexey Novikov adapts styles of the avant-garde period to create images that are often caricatures. When Malevich used the image of the peasant, rural life and the wrenching changes it was undergoing were central to Russia's evolution. Alexey Novikov seems to choose similar subjects in a tone of nostalgia for a quaint and lost past. Igor Novikov was trained in Moscow in the 1970s and in the last years of the Soviet Union became associated with different groups of nonconformist artists. Superimposing cartoonish figures on subjects painted realistically, often alluding to canonical paintings, he caricatures and deflates norms. 139 p., 29 cm, approx. 100 color illus., ENGLISH.
